目的 :观察蝎毒抗癌多肽纯化组分Ⅲ (antineoplasticpolypeptide ⅢfromAPBMV ,AP Ⅲ )对小鼠肝癌 (hep atoma 2 2 ,H2 2 )的生长抑制作用及对带瘤小鼠胸腺重量的影响。方法 :将接种H2 2 细胞 2 4h后的昆明种小鼠 6 5只 ,随机分为 5组 :5 Fu组 1 0只 (2 0mg/kg) ;APBMV组 1 0只 (0 .0 4mg/kg) ;AP Ⅲ实验组 (Ⅰ :0 .0 4mg/kg ,Ⅱ :0 .0 3mg/kg) ,每组 1 0只 ;非正常对照组 2 5只 (生理盐水 ) ,均腹腔注射给药 ,1次 /d ,连续给药 1 0d。于末次给药 2 4h后 ,颈椎脱臼处死小鼠 ,剥离肿瘤和胸腺 ,称重 ,并作数据处理。结果 :AP Ⅲ实验组和APBMV组对H2 2 有明显的抑制作用 ,与非正常对照组比较差异有显著性 (P <0 .0 1或P <0 .0 0 1 ) ;5 Fu组胸腺质量低于非正常对照组 ,而AP Ⅲ实验组和APBMV组则高于或接近非正常对照组。结论 :AP Ⅲ具有抑制H2 2 生长的作用 ,高剂量的AP Ⅲ可增加带瘤小鼠胸腺的重量
Objective: To observe the growth inhibitory effect of antineoplastic polypeptide III from APBMV (AP III) on hepatocellular carcinoma (hep atoma 2 2 , H2 2) and the effect on the weight of thymus in tumor-bearing mice. METHODS: Sixty-five Kunming mice were inoculated with H2 2 cells for 24 hours and randomly divided into 5 groups: 10 in the 5 Fu group (20 mg/kg); 10 in the APBMV group (0.04 mg/kg). ); AP III experimental group (I :0. 04mg/kg, II :0. 03mg/kg), 10 in each group; 25 non-normal control groups (physiological saline), were injected intraperitoneally, Once/d, continuous administration of 10d. After the last administration 24 hours later, the mice were killed by cervical dislocation, and the tumors and thymus were dissected, weighed, and processed for data processing. Results: AP III group and APBMV group had significant inhibitory effect on H 2 2 , compared with the non-normal control group (P <0.01 or P <0.01); 5 Fu group thymus mass Lower than the non-normal control group, while the AP III experimental group and APBMV group were higher than or close to the non-normal control group. Conclusion : AP III can inhibit the growth of H2 2 , and high dose of AP III can increase the weight of thymus in tumor-bearing mice.
